WATCH: The key moment from Sao Paulo as Hamilton takes the lead from Verstappen
From P10 on the grid Lewis Hamilton set about chasing down car after car ahead of him at Interlagos on Sunday afternoon, until he came up behind his title rival Max Verstappen.
He harried and hustled the Red Bull man, never far from his rear wing as they thundered around the Sao Paulo circuit. But could he get past? We got our answer on Lap 59 when he managed to make a move stick and the crowd erupted in response. And from there he raced on to a famous victory.
